Ricki Lake's shakes take her to the top of 'Dancing With The Stars'

In their Jive, Lake matched the energy of Hough, who is known for his tricky choreography and pushing his partners beyond their limits.

Their Jive got the highest score of the night, 23 out of 30.

Judge Bruno Tonioli told Lake she was the only performer to do all her flicks and kicks correctly.

A point behind and tied for second were Kristin Cavallari with partner Mark Ballas for their Quickstep and J.R. Martinez with partner Karina Smirnoff for their Jive.

"This week, I just wanted to come out there and show them I do have personality and I can bring it to my dancing, and I think that's what I did," Cavallari said.

Then there was a four-way tie for fourth place. Elisabetta Canalis, Rob Kardashian, Chynna Phillips and Nancy Grace all scored 21 points.

"I've never been a good dancer in my life so now I'm working a lot," Canalis said.

Her partner, Val Chmerkovskiy, said they were better prepared and she was more confident because of that.

The judges enjoyed Phillips' dance but all thought she played it a little safe.

"I am going to bring a little more va-voom, a little more sexiness next week and hopefully the scores will be a little higher," Phillips said.

Hope Solo and partner Maksim Chmerkovskiy came next with a score of 19 for their soccer-inspired Jive.

"I had a smile on my face for the first time the entire performance and I was really happy just performing," Solo said.

David Arquette's Jive got him 18 out of 30 points. Judges Len Goodman and Tonioli complimented Arquette's enthusiasm, but told him he needs to focus on technique.

Carson Kressley also scored 18. The judges all gave him kudos for his entertainment value

Despite a strong effort, Chaz Bono finished at the bottom with 17 points.

"Right now, I'm probably in the worst shape but, hopefully in a couple days I'll be feeling better and just keep going," Bono said.

One of the 11 remaining couples will be eliminated Tuesday night.
